Best touring cycling routes in Oulton Broad are characterized by their proximity to the Broads National Park and the Suffolk coastline. The terrain is generally flat, offering accessible cycling along waterways and through coastal towns. This area provides a network of paths suitable for touring cyclists looking to explore the East Anglian landscape.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the general difficulty level of touring cycling routes in Oulton Broad?

The touring cycling routes around Oulton Broad are generally flat, offering accessible cycling for various skill levels. The majority of the 33 available routes are rated as easy or moderate, with only a few considered difficult, making the area suitable for a wide range of cyclists.

Are there easy cycling routes suitable for beginners in Oulton Broad?

Yes, Oulton Broad offers several easy cycling routes perfect for beginners. For instance, the Lowestoft Seafront – Lowestoft Seafront Beach loop from Oulton Broad South is an easy 19.4-mile (31.2 km) trail. Another accessible option is the Most Easterly Point of England – Lowestoft Seafront loop from Oulton Broad South, which is 17.7 miles (28.5 km) long.

Are there any longer touring cycling routes for experienced cyclists?

For experienced cyclists looking for a longer ride, the Walberswick Ferry Crossing – Southwold Harbour loop from Oulton Broad South is a moderate 46.2-mile (74.3 km) route. This trail offers a more extended exploration of the Suffolk coastline and takes you towards Southwold Harbour.

Where can I find parking for cycling routes around Oulton Broad?

Parking is generally available in and around Oulton Broad, particularly near popular starting points like Nicolas Everitt Park. Many coastal towns and villages along the routes, such as Lowestoft and Southwold, also offer public car parks. It's advisable to check local council websites for specific parking locations and any associated fees.

Is Oulton Broad accessible by public transport for cyclists?

Oulton Broad is well-connected by public transport. Oulton Broad South and Oulton Broad North train stations provide access to the area, and some train services allow bicycles, though restrictions may apply during peak hours. Local bus services also operate, but their capacity for bikes can be limited. Always check with the transport provider beforehand.

Are there cafes or pubs along the touring cycling routes in Oulton Broad?

Yes, the touring cycling routes around Oulton Broad often pass through or near towns and villages with various cafes and pubs. You'll find refreshment stops in Lowestoft, Southwold, and Gorleston, as well as in Oulton Broad itself, particularly around Nicolas Everitt Park. These establishments provide convenient places to refuel during your ride.

Are most touring cycling routes in Oulton Broad circular?

Many of the touring cycling routes in Oulton Broad are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. Examples include the Nicolas Everitt Park – View of Southwold seafront loop from Oulton Broad South and the Gorleston Beach Promenade – Lowestoft Seafront loop from Oulton Broad South. This makes planning your ride and return journey straightforward.

What kind of views or natural sights can I expect on Oulton Broad cycling routes?

Cycling around Oulton Broad offers diverse views, from the tranquil waterways of the Broads National Park to the expansive Suffolk coastline. You can expect to see highlights like View of Oulton Broad, Lound Lakes Nature Reserve, and coastal scenery along Gorleston Beach. The flat terrain ensures open vistas of the East Anglian landscape.

What interesting landmarks or attractions can I visit while cycling around Oulton Broad?

Along your cycling routes, you can explore several interesting landmarks and attractions. These include the Most Easterly Point of England near Lowestoft, historical sites like St Andrew's Church Ruins, Covehithe, and scenic viewpoints such as Beccles Old Bridge and Castle Marshes Nature Reserve.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Oulton Broad?

The best time for touring cycling in Oulton Broad is typically from spring to early autumn (April to October). During these months, the weather is generally milder and drier, making for more pleasant riding conditions. The Broads and coastal areas are particularly beautiful in late spring and summer.

Can I cycle in Oulton Broad during winter?

While cycling is possible year-round, winter cycling in Oulton Broad requires more preparation. The flat terrain means routes are less prone to heavy snow, but you should be prepared for colder temperatures, potential rain, and shorter daylight hours. Coastal paths can also be exposed to strong winds. Always check weather forecasts and ensure your bike is well-maintained for winter conditions.
